Specialized experience required: : At least one FULL year of specialized experience at or equivalent to at least the GS-13 grade level in the Federal service. Specialized experience is defined as experience providing comprehensive advice and guidance on military HR management regulations/ policies; providing technical training to support military HR personnel actions and systems; and, analyzing military HR program information to identify necessary corrective actions. Only MSP/PPP applicants currently occupying a formal training program position are entitled to exercise their priority status. Interagency Career Transition Assistance Program (ICTAP). If you are a Federal employee in the competitive service and your agency has notified you in writing that you are a displaced employee eligible for ICTAP consideration, you may receive selection priority for this position. To receive selection priority, you must: (1) meet ICTAP eligibility criteria (2) be rated well-qualified for the position and; (3) submit the appropriate documentation to support your ICTAP eligibility. To be considered well-qualified and receive selection priority applicants must satisfy all qualification requirements for the position and receive a score of 90 or above.
